Alibaba is under scrutiny after reports surfaced that the company utilized 25,000 accounts to mine Claude AI, generating a staggering 28.8 million exchanges. This incident not only raises ethical concerns but also threatens Alibaba’s reputation in the competitive AI landscape. The implications of this hack could reshape trust dynamics in AI development and usage, making it a crucial moment for the industry.

This incident involves the unauthorized extraction of AI model responses by leveraging a vast number of user accounts. Specifically, Alibaba is accused of orchestrating a massive data mining operation targeting Claude AI, a sophisticated language model. By creating and managing 25,000 accounts, the company was able to engage in over 28.8 million exchanges, potentially violating user agreements and intellectual property rights. The technical mechanics of this operation highlight vulnerabilities in API access and user authentication protocols that could affect other platforms as well.
